Artist's Description
Usually I like to work en Plein air (outside with my easel) but in the Winter this isn't always possible. So when my friend Barbara Goldhamer showed me a gorgeous photo of Harvard Square that a homeless acquaintance showed her, I fell in love. We asked permission to use it and he agreed. I feel he has a unique perspective, by living on the streets. He knows the city in a way few others would. His name is Kevin P. Tyler.
About Debra Bretton Robinson
Debra Bretton Robinson grew up in Plaistow, NH and received her degree from the Mass College of Art in Boston. She and her family reside in MA. Debra is now a participant in the vibrant Lowell, MA art scene. Her acrylic paintings on canvas concentrate on the natural landscapes and architecture of New England in vibrating colors. Most of her work is done "en plein air" or on site, outdoors. Frequently her scenes are painted while on her “floating studio”, her husband’s boat, while he fishes. Her style borders between representational and abstract. The colors and lines of her paintings are inspired by Matisse during the Fauvist movement.
